.js .filter-wrapper .filter-load-wrapper{display:none}@media screen and (min-width:768px){.filter-wrapper.filters__horizontal .filter-target{display:flex;z-index:1000}.filter-wrapper.filters__horizontal .filter-target .filter-pane{flex-grow:1;padding:10px}}.filter-wrapper.filters__horizontal .filter-target .filter-heading,.filter-textarea{display:none}.theme-editor .filter-textarea{display:block}.filter-textarea textarea{width:100%;resize:vertical;padding:5px;box-sizing:border-box}.js .filter-collapsible-button[data-collapsible-trigger]{display:inline-block}@media screen and (min-width:768px){.js .filter-collapsible-button[data-collapsible-trigger]{display:none}}.filter-collapsible-wrapper{display:none}.collapsible__is-open .filter-collapsible-wrapper{display:block}@media screen and (min-width:768px){.filter-collapsible-wrapper{display:block}}.filter-heading{display:none}@media screen and (min-width:768px){.filter-heading{display:block}}.filter-list-item{position:relative}.filter-list-item input{position:absolute;left:0;top:2px}.filter-list-item label{padding-left:26px;display:block;cursor:pointer;-webkit-user-select:none;user-select:none}.filter-list-item.filter-list-item__color{overflow:hidden;position:relative}.filter-list-item.filter-list-item__color input{left:-100%}.filter-list-item.filter-list-item__color input:checked+label .filter-color{box-shadow:0 0 0 1px inset #ccc2b9}.filter-list-item.filter-list-item__color .filter-color{display:block;width:14px;height:14px;position:absolute;left:0;top:50%;transform:translateY(-50%);border:1px solid #ccc2b9;border-radius:4px}.filter-list.level-1[data-collapsible-parent] .filter-hideable__true,.filter-list.level-1[data-collapsible-parent] .filter-less{display:none}.filter-list.level-1[data-collapsible-parent].collapsible__is-open .filter-hideable__true,.filter-list.level-1[data-collapsible-parent].collapsible__is-open .filter-less{display:block}.filter-list.level-1[data-collapsible-parent].collapsible__is-open .filter-more{display:none}.filter-pane.filter__navigation .filter-items .filter-list.level-1 .filter-list-item.level-1{padding:0}.filter-pane.filter__navigation .filter-items .filter-list.level-1 .filter-list-item.level-1 .filter-link.level-1{padding-left:26px;line-height:29px;font-weight:300}.filter-pane.filter__navigation .filter-items .filter-list.level-1 .filter-list-item.level-1 .filter-link.level-1:before{content:"";position:absolute;left:4px;top:50%;transform:translateY(-50%);width:9px;height:9px;z-index:5;background:#fff;display:block}.filter-pane.filter__navigation .filter-items .filter-list.level-1 .filter-list-item.level-1 .filter-link.level-1:after{content:"";display:block;position:absolute;left:0;top:50%;transform:translateY(-50%);width:15px;height:15px;border:1px solid #000;background:#fff;transition:background .1s ease-in-out;z-index:1}.filter-pane.filter__navigation .filter-items .filter-list.level-1 .filter-list-item.level-1.link-active__true .filter-link.level-1{font-weight:700}.filter-pane.filter__navigation .filter-items .filter-list.level-1 .filter-list-item.level-1.link-active__true .filter-link.level-1:before{background:#000}.filter-pane.filter__navigation .filter-items .filter-list.level-2{padding:0 0 0 10px}.filter-pane.filter__navigation .filter-items .filter-list.level-2 .filter-list-item.level-2{padding:0}.filter-pane.filter__navigation .filter-items .filter-list.level-2 .filter-list-item.level-2 .filter-link.level-2{padding-left:26px;line-height:29px;font-weight:300}.filter-pane.filter__navigation .filter-items .filter-list.level-2 .filter-list-item.level-2 .filter-link.level-2:before{content:"";position:absolute;left:4px;top:50%;transform:translateY(-50%);width:9px;height:9px;z-index:5;background:#fff;display:block}.filter-pane.filter__navigation .filter-items .filter-list.level-2 .filter-list-item.level-2 .filter-link.level-2:after{content:"";display:block;position:absolute;left:0;top:50%;transform:translateY(-50%);width:15px;height:15px;border:1px solid #000;background:#fff;transition:background .1s ease-in-out;z-index:1}.filter-pane.filter__navigation .filter-items .filter-list.level-2 .filter-list-item.level-2.link-active__true .filter-link.level-2{font-weight:700}.filter-pane.filter__navigation .filter-items .filter-list.level-2 .filter-list-item.level-2.link-active__true .filter-link.level-2:before{background:#000}.collection-template .collection-top .page-row-content .breadcrumbs .page-side-spacing{padding-left:0;padding-right:0}.collection-template .collection-top .page-row-content .row{margin-top:0}.collection-template .collection-top .page-row-content .row .col-content{padding-top:20px;padding-bottom:20px;box-sizing:border-box}.collection-template .collection-top .page-row-content .row .col-content .page-row.breadcrumbs{margin-top:0;margin-bottom:20px}.collection-template .collection-top .page-row-content .row .col-content .collection-content-text{display:flex;flex-direction:column;align-items:flex-start;justify-content:center;min-height:calc(100% - 85px);padding:20px 0}@media screen and (max-width:479px){.collection-template .collection-top .page-row-content .row .col-content .collection-content-text h1{max-width:66vw}}@media screen and (max-width:479px){.collection-template .collection-top .page-row-content .row .col-content .collection-description{max-width:66vw}}@media screen and (max-width:360px){.collection-template .collection-top .page-row-content .row .col-content .collection-description{max-width:unset}}.collection-template .collection-top .page-row-content .row .col-content .collection-description p,.collection-template .collection-top .page-row-content .row .col-content .collection-description p span{font-size:.875rem;line-height:1.125rem;margin:14px 0}@media screen and (min-width:480px){.collection-template .collection-top .page-row-content .row .col-content .collection-description p,.collection-template .collection-top .page-row-content .row .col-content .collection-description p span{font-size:1rem;line-height:1.25rem}}@media screen and (min-width:768px){.collection-template .collection-top .page-row-content .row .col-content .collection-description p,.collection-template .collection-top .page-row-content .row .col-content .collection-description p span{font-size:1.125rem;line-height:1.375rem}}@media screen and (min-width:1024px){.collection-template .collection-top .page-row-content .row .col-content .collection-description p,.collection-template .collection-top .page-row-content .row .col-content .collection-description p span{font-size:1.375rem;line-height:1.75rem;margin:20px 0}}.collection-template .collection-top .page-row-content .row .col-image{padding-top:20px;padding-bottom:20px;min-height:200px;height:auto;box-sizing:border-box}@media screen and (max-width:479px){.collection-template .collection-top .page-row-content .row .col-image{position:absolute;right:10px;top:26px;max-width:20vw;max-height:25vw;min-height:unset}}.collection-template .collection-top .page-row-content .row .col-image .img.img__responsive.img__right{margin-left:0;max-width:100%}@media screen and (min-width:768px){.collection-template .collection-top .page-row-content .row .col-image .img.img__responsive.img__right{width:100%;height:100%;max-height:275px;position:relative}.collection-template .collection-top .page-row-content .row .col-image .img.img__responsive.img__right img{position:relative;right:0;top:50%;transform:translateY(-50%);max-height:100%;width:auto;float:right}}@media screen and (max-width:767px){.collection-page{z-index:2}}.collection-column-products .collection-nav{margin:0 -8px 10px}@media screen and (min-width:768px){.collection-column-products .collection-nav{margin:8px 0 15px}}.collection-column-products .collection-nav .collection-product-amount{box-sizing:border-box;font-size:.75rem;font-weight:400;color:#aca298}@media screen and (max-width:767px){.collection-column-products .collection-nav .collection-product-amount{border-top:1px solid #ccc2b9;padding:7px 0;text-align:center}}@media screen and (min-width:768px){.collection-column-products .collection-nav .collection-product-amount{font-size:.875rem;padding-top:13px;padding-left:10px}}.collection-column-sorting .collection-sorting{float:right;position:relative;margin:0}.collection-column-sorting .collection-sorting .form-label{position:absolute;top:50%;transform:translateY(-50%);right:18px}.collection-column-sorting .collection-sorting .form-label label{display:block;position:relative;width:100%;padding:0;color:#3f3d3b;margin:0;font-weight:300;font-size:.75rem;line-height:3rem}@media screen and (min-width:768px){.collection-column-sorting .collection-sorting .form-label label{font-size:.875rem}}.collection-column-sorting .collection-sorting .form-input.form-input__select select{background:0 0;border-color:#fff;color:transparent;padding:0;cursor:pointer;-webkit-user-select:none;user-select:none;position:relative;font-size:.75rem}@media screen and (min-width:768px){.collection-column-sorting .collection-sorting .form-input.form-input__select select{font-size:.875rem}}.collection-column-sorting .collection-sorting .form-input.form-input__select:before{content:""}.collection-column-sorting .collection-sorting .form-input.form-input__select:after{font-family:LineAwesome;content:"\f105";color:#3f3d3b;right:0;width:20px;position:absolute;top:0;transform:none;font-size:.75rem;line-height:3rem}@media screen and (min-width:768px){.collection-column-sorting .collection-sorting .form-input.form-input__select:after{font-size:.875rem}}.collection-productlinks{margin-top:0}.collection-description-wrapper .row{position:relative}.collection-description-wrapper .col-content{display:flex;justify-content:center;flex-direction:column;padding-top:22px;padding-bottom:40px}@media screen and (min-width:1024px){.collection-description-wrapper .col-content{padding-top:8px;padding-bottom:8px}}@media screen and (max-width:767px){.collection-description-wrapper .col-content h2,.collection-description-wrapper .col-content h3{max-width:70%}}@media screen and (max-width:479px){.collection-description-wrapper .col-content h2,.collection-description-wrapper .col-content h3{max-width:calc(100% - 113px)}}.collection-description-wrapper .col-content .collection-description{margin-top:30px;margin-bottom:10px}@media screen and (min-width:1024px){.collection-description-wrapper .col-content .collection-description{margin-top:49px}}.collection-description-wrapper .col-content .collection-description p{font-size:.75rem;line-height:22px}@media screen and (min-width:768px){.collection-description-wrapper .col-content .collection-description p{font-size:.875rem;line-height:24px}}@media screen and (min-width:1024px){.collection-description-wrapper .col-content .collection-description p{font-size:1rem;line-height:26px}}@media screen and (max-width:767px){.collection-description-wrapper .col-description-image{position:absolute;right:0;top:22px;width:115px}.collection-description-wrapper .col-description-image .img.img__responsive{padding-bottom:0;height:76px}}@media screen and (min-width:768px){.collection-description-wrapper .col-description-image .img.img__responsive{padding-bottom:77%}}.row-pagination{margin-top:29px}@media screen and (min-width:1024px){.row-pagination{margin-top:50px}}.row-pagination .col{display:flex;justify-content:center;align-items:center}.row-pagination .col .pagination-next,.row-pagination .col .pagination-prev{width:20px;height:20px;display:flex;justify-content:center;align-items:center;font-size:.875rem;line-height:20px}.row-pagination .col .collection-pagination{padding:0 50px}.row-pagination .col .collection-pagination li{display:inline-flex;justify-content:center;align-items:center;width:20px;height:20px;font-size:.875rem;letter-spacing:2;line-height:20px}.row-pagination .col .collection-pagination li.active{font-weight:700}.filter-wrapper{position:relative}.js .filter-wrapper .filter-target [data-collapsible-trigger]{display:block}.filter-pane{margin:23px 0 42px;box-sizing:border-box}.filter-pane a{display:block;position:relative;color:#000}@media screen and (max-width:767px){.filter-pane .filter-items{max-height:10000px}}.filter-pane-title{font-weight:500;margin-bottom:13px;position:relative;display:block;font-size:1rem}@media screen and (min-width:768px){.filter-pane-title{font-size:1rem}}.filter-pane-title .filter-pane-trigger{right:10px}.filter-pane-trigger{position:absolute;right:0;font-size:16px}.filter-list-item{padding:0 0 12px}.filter-list-item label{line-height:120%}.filter-list-item label:active,.filter-list-item label:focus,.filter-list-item label:hover{text-decoration:underline;color:#000}.filter-list-item label:active:before,.filter-list-item label:focus:before,.filter-list-item label:hover:before{text-decoration:none}.filter-list-item label:before{content:"";position:absolute;left:4px;top:4px;width:10px;height:10px;z-index:5;background:#fff;display:block}.filter-list-item label:after{content:"";display:block;position:absolute;left:0;top:1px;width:15px;height:15px;border:1px solid #000;background:#fff;transition:background .1s ease-in-out;z-index:1}.filter-list-item input[type=checkbox]{background-color:#fff;border-color:#fff;color:#fff}.filter-list-item input[type=checkbox]:checked+label{font-weight:700}.filter-list-item input[type=checkbox]:checked+label:before{background:#000}.filter-list-item.filter-list-item__color label:after,.filter-list-item.filter-list-item__color label:before{content:none}.filter-link.level-2{padding-left:20px}.filter-link.level-3{padding-left:40px}.js .filter-toggler[data-collapsible-trigger]{cursor:pointer;font-size:80%;color:#aca298;text-transform:uppercase;padding:0;border-top:1px solid #ccc2b9}.filter-remove-tag{padding-left:25px}.filter-remove-tag:before{font-family:LineAwesome;content:"\f00d";position:absolute;left:0;top:50%;transform:translateY(-50%);width:16px;line-height:1rem;font-size:10px;font-weight:700;z-index:5;color:#000;text-align:center}.filter-remove-tag:after{content:"";display:block;position:absolute;left:0;top:50%;transform:translateY(-50%);width:14px;height:14px;border:1px solid #dedede;background:#fff;transition:background .1s ease-in-out;z-index:1;border-radius:4px}.filter-wrapper .filter-collapsible-button{display:inline-block;margin:15px 0 13px;position:relative;padding:0;line-height:120%;font-size:.75rem;color:#3f3d3b}.filter-wrapper .filter-collapsible-button:after{font-family:LineAwesome;content:"\f105";color:#3f3d3b;right:-15px;position:absolute;top:50%;transform:translateY(-50%);font-size:.75rem}@media screen and (min-width:768px){.filter-wrapper .filter-collapsible-button:after{font-size:.875rem}}.filter-wrapper.collapsible__is-open .filter-collapsible-wrapper{display:block}@media screen and (max-width:479px){.filter-wrapper.collapsible__is-open .filter-collapsible-wrapper{width:80vw}}@media screen and (max-width:767px){.filter-collapsible-wrapper{border:1px solid #dedede;padding:0 20px;position:absolute;left:0;right:0;background:#fff;box-shadow:0 2px 7px 1px #0003}}
/*# sourceMappingURL=/s/files/1/0361/5342/6057/t/31/assets/code-theme-collection.css.map */
